The protein can be really high but it depends on the cheese. All cheese are fat and protein but dessert cheeses like the mold ones are much lower in protein and higher in fats, other cheeses are higher in protein and has less fat. Water content also varies. Mozzarella has low on both because of the water but parmesan is high on both because it's super dry. However the fats are not unhealthy but make sure to fit them in your overall calorie intake. The protein is of very high quality but it's all casein. This means it digests slowly. The protein per dollar is actually quite good on really cheap cheeses. I recommend cheese. Makes food taste amazing as well. The trans fat problem is not a real problem. Dairy fat intake is not linked to disease. It's actually the opposite.
Source: https://journals.plos.org/plosmedicine/article?id=10.1371/journal.pmed.1003763
The people who eat the most dairy fat are the healthiest. Processed meats like bacon is the problem, not dairy fat. Unprocessed meat is ok though.
